Reorganise a little to prepare for locking fixes:

- in sccnopen(), open the keyboard before the screen.  The keyboard
  currently requires Giant (although it must be spinlocked to work
  correctly as a console), so the previous order would be a LOR if
  it has any semblance of locking.
- add a (currently dummy) state arg to scgetc().
